Transaction 17ff86f79cdd521ae2cd3dcd1bd20e19db3037035cdc42e44881e036bb54676a

1 Input
2 Outputs
  • 17ff86f79cdd521ae2cd3dcd1bd20e19db3037035cdc42e44881e036bb54676a:0
  • value  4606400
    address  3ENVcaQg6XHBF8qMKMi8tNTYcm2Kk4ehDy
  • 17ff86f79cdd521ae2cd3dcd1bd20e19db3037035cdc42e44881e036bb54676a:1
  • value  20000
    address  1FEL7RvFc4L6jp8VmgDWeupYAuGsjvGqk6